Saratoga Springs, NY has gone from being the “August Place to Be” to an exciting, culturally sophisticated, year round destination.

This, in no small part, is because of the cooperation of the Downtown Business Association, Convention and Tourism Bureau, the City Center, Chamber of Commerce, Special Assessment District, our local government, police force, Preservation Foundation, and the Historical Society.

The Saratoga Springs Downtown Business Association is literally paving the way for Saratoga Springs and its future, we have different challenges to face, new, fresh faces adding to the talent pool and hopefully a greater number of members becoming involved. The talent, brainpower and resources for success are all here.

Appalachian Trail hiking record holder Jennifer Pharr-Davis to present programs at Saratoga Springs library
SARATOGA SPRINGS — Jennifer Pharr-Davis has hiked more than 12,000 miles on long-distance trails. She has trekked on six continents and currently holds endurance records on three separate trails. In 2011, Pharr-Davis became the first woman to claim the overall speed record on the Appalachian Trail by finishing the 2,181-mile journey in 46 days, 11 hours and 20 minutes — an astounding average of 46.9 miles per day.
